facebookログイン認証について
自分でサービスを作って公開していたサービスなのですが、
基本人が来ないので気づかなかったんですが、
2ヶ月ぶりぐらいにfacebookログイン認証をつかったところ以下エラーになっていました。
ClientException in RequestException.php line 107: Client error: `GET https://graph.facebook.com/v2.6/me?access_token=&fields=name,email,gender,verified&appsecret_proof=[何かのハッシュ]` resulted in a `400 Bad Request` response: {"error":{"message":"An active access token must be used to query information about the current user.","type":"OAuthExce (truncated...) ```。 callbackの$facebook = $this->socialite->driver('facebook')->user();のところでエラーとなるようです。 エラーメッセージで検索したのですが、昔の情報が引っかかるぐらいで、それらしい情報はありませんでした。 facebook開発ページでアプリを確認したところ1024アイコンが必須?になってるのとcallbackurlが必須?にになってるようだったので、 追加してみましたが、同様のエラーでした。 An active access token must be usedとあったので、アクティブになってないのかと思いましたが、 facebook開発のアプリページでは緑色の点が表示されており公開状態となってます。 以下は正常に値が入ってました。 laravel/config/services.php ```ここに言語を入力 'facebook' => [ 'client_id' => env('FACEBOOK_ID'), 'client_secret' => env('FACEBOOK_SECRET'), 'redirect' => env('FACEBOOK_CALLBACKURL'), ],
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/04/20 07:16
2017/04/20 07:17
2017/04/20 07:23 編集